Developer "Hal9k" and "Malaysk" create custom ROMs for MTK units. Their websites contain MTK 8227L firmware links for a small donation ($15–$20). These ROMs remove bloatware and improve speed but require precise MCU matching.

| Symptom | Fix |
|---------|-----|
| No boot, PC sees “MediaTek USB Port” | Reflash preloader only |
| Black screen, but backlight on | Wrong LCD driver – restore original lk.bin |
| Touchscreen reversed | Replace tp (touch panel) files from old firmware |
